What Are Agreement surety Bonds?



Contract surety bonds are vital tools in the construction and contracting industry. They provide a warranty that you'll fulfill your obligations under an agreement.

Basically, these bonds involve three parties: you, the project proprietor, and the surety firm. When you safeguard a surety bond, you guarantee the project owner that you'll complete the work and fulfill all conditions.

If you stop working to do so, the surety company presumes obligation and makes up the project proprietor for any kind of financial loss. This bonding procedure not only shields the proprietor however additionally boosts your reputation and credibility on the market.
